What does a merchandiser in retail do?
Career: Merchandiser In Retail
A merchandiser in retail is responsible for ensuring that products are displayed in an appealing and organized manner to maximize sales. Their duties often include stocking shelves, arranging displays, monitoring inventory levels, and analyzing sales trends to recommend product placement or promotions. Merchandisers work closely with store managers and suppliers to ensure that the right products are available at the right time and in the right quantities. Their efforts directly impact the shopping experience and can influence customer purchasing decisions.
